If you have ever thought about entertained the idea to join a Board but not sure how to go about it … you'll enjoy this podcast. David explains what is actually involved in putting people on Boards. He takes us through the process, training and requirements to be eligible to be on Board whether it be a not for profit, Government and Committee or profit. It seems it is more challenging and a highly competitive activity. David also shares his knowledge on some of the risks and rewards for Non Executive Directors and of course the Chair. We also start to unravel the 7 strands of Diversity which is a separate podcast in its own right. We thank Davis for his insights.
